Report Says State Approves $500 Million More of READI Funds Coming

Inside Indiana Business is reporting that the Indiana Economic Development Corporation board of directors on Thursday approved $500 million in funding from the second round of the Regional Economic Acceleration and Development Initiative, or READI 2.0.

The regional funding allocations were announced by Gov. Eric Holcomb and the IEDC at the agency’ public meeting in Indianapolis.

The report also said that six regions each received the highest allocation of $45 million, and the IEDC said based on plans outlined in the regions’ funding applications, the grants are expected to yield about $11 billion in additional public and private investment.
